Embracing Renewable Energy

West Coast fulfillment centers increasingly harness renewable energy sources like solar and wind. By investing in solar panels and utilizing wind energy, they reduce reliance on fossil fuels. A notable example is Amazon’s fulfillment centers in California, which have been equipped with large solar panel arrays to power operations sustainably.

In short: Leveraging renewables reduces environmental impact and lowers energy costs.

Efficient Logistics Systems

Optimizing logistics is crucial for sustainability. Many companies adopt advanced software that uses AI to enhance route planning and inventory management. This reduces travel distances and energy use. Companies like Google are developing technologies to refine delivery systems, thereby enhancing efficiency.

In short: Better logistics drive sustainability by reducing energy consumption.

Sustainable Packaging Solutions

Sustainable packaging is about using recycled and biodegradable materials. West Coast companies like EcoEnclose offer innovative packaging solutions that minimize waste. Utilizing compostable mailers and recycled materials helps reduce landfill waste and encourages eco-friendly practices.

In short: Eco-friendly packaging cuts waste and supports sustainability goals.

Green Transportation Choices

Adopting eco-friendly transportation is another significant trend. Many firms now use electric vehicles (EVs) and hybrid trucks. California’s push for electric vehicle adoption helps reduce emissions drastically. Firms like UPS are transitioning to greener fleets in their West Coast operations.

In short: EVs and hybrids cut emissions and align with environmental mandates.

FAQs

What is the main driver for sustainable practices in order fulfillment?
Increasing consumer demand for environmentally-friendly products and regulatory pressures are the primary drivers.

How do renewable energies benefit fulfillment centers?
They significantly reduce carbon footprints and energy costs, improving a company’s sustainability profile.

Why are sustainable packaging solutions important?
They reduce waste and the environmental impacts of packaging, appealing to eco-conscious consumers.

What is the role of technology in sustainable fulfillment?
Technology, especially AI and IoT, optimizes logistics, reducing unnecessary energy use and enhancing overall efficiency.

How do sustainable practices impact company reputation?
By adopting sustainability, companies enhance their brand image, attract eco-conscious customers, and comply with evolving regulations.
